 | | Next to the spectatcularly boring 6GB HDP-M3000, Sanyo is also coming up with something more distinctive flash-based DMP-Mx00 series.
These things look like short, square straws (at a size of 87x15.6×15.6mm) , yet despite this fact they do come with (long-stretched, 1-line, multi-color backlit) LCD screens. MP3 and WMA (DRM, except for version nr 10) are supported and there's an FM tuner in there as well.
There's the M600 (512MB capacity) and the 1GB M700, in a wide variety of colors to choose from. Japanese MSRPs are 18k Yen and 23k Yen (512MB, 1GB respectively), which boils down to some 130 and 170 Euro/Dollar and all.
